General information
The Ukrainian Carpathians and Transcarpathia are the mountain and culturally diverse face of the country, with meadows, forests, wooden churches, villages, thermal springs, castles and winter resorts.
Trips and nature
The Carpathians are Ukraine’s main mountain region. Hoverla is the highest mountain, Synevyr a famous mountain lake and the polonynas offer beautiful ridge walks.
Food and atmosphere
The area is shaped by Hutsul, Rusyn, Hungarian, Slovak, Romanian and Ukrainian influences. Food is mountain-style: banosh, brynza, mushrooms, borscht, varenyky, smoked products, honey and herbal teas.
Transport and stay
Official safety advice must still be checked. In normal conditions, the area is reached by train, bus or car from Lviv, Ivano-Frankivsk or Uzhhorod.
